Question:

A round casting is 0.3 m in diameter and 0.5 m in length. Another casting of the same metal is elliptical in cross section, with a major-to-minor axis ratio of 3, and has the same length and cross sectional area as the round casting. Both pieces are cast under the same conditions. What is the difference in the solidification times of the two castings?
